private void SetData() { try { // If edit po if (ObjPurchaseOrder.POId > 0) { lblPOCode.Text = ObjPurchaseOrder.POCode.Trim(); Supplier supplier = new Supplier(); supplier.SupId = ObjPurchaseOrder.SupId; if (supplier.GetSupplierByID()) { lblSupplier.Text = supplier.SupplierName; } if (Decimal.Round((ObjPurchaseOrder.POAmount - ObjPurchaseOrder.BalanceAmount), 2) == 0) { lblTotalPaid.Text = String.Empty; } else { lblTotalPaid.Text = Decimal.Round((ObjPurchaseOrder.POAmount - ObjPurchaseOrder.BalanceAmount), 2).ToString(); } lblBalancePayment.Text = Decimal.Round(ObjPurchaseOrder.BalanceAmount, 2).ToString(); lblPOAmount.Text = Decimal.Round(ObjPurchaseOrder.POAmount, 2).ToString(); if (ObjPurchaseOrder.RequestedBy.HasValue) { User user = new User(); user.UserId = ObjPurchaseOrder.RequestedBy.Value; new UsersDAO().GetUserByID(user); lblRequestedBy.Text = user.FirstName; } gvItemList.DataSource = ObjPurchaseOrder.DsPOItems; gvItemList.DataBind(); } } catch (Exception ex) { throw ex; } }
protected void ddlSuppliers_SelectedIndexChanged(object sender, EventArgs e) { try { if (ddlSuppliers.SelectedValue != "-1") { Supplier sup = new Supplier(); sup.SupId = Int32.Parse(ddlSuppliers.SelectedValue.Trim()); sup.GetSupplierByID(); txtAmmount.Text = Decimal.Round(sup.CreditAmmount, 2).ToString(); btnCalculate.Visible = false; } else { txtAmmount.Text = String.Empty; btnCalculate.Visible = false; } } catch (Exception ex) { throw ex; } }